     16 # this script is used to record an application definition in the
     17 # NDK build system, before performing any build whatsoever.
     18 #
     19 # It is included repeatedly from build/core/main.mk and expects a
     20 # variable named '_application_mk' which points to a given Application.mk
     21 # file that will be included here. The latter must define a few variables
     22 # to describe the application to the build system, and the rest of the
     23 # code here will perform book-keeping and basic checks
     24 #
